namespace Google\Service\Safebrowsing\Resource;
use Google\Service\Safebrowsing\GoogleSecuritySafebrowsingV4FetchThreatListUpdatesRequest;
use Google\Service\Safebrowsing\GoogleSecuritySafebrowsingV4FetchThreatListUpdatesResponse;
/**
* The "threatListUpdates" collection of methods.
* Typical usage is:
* <code>
* $safebrowsingService = new Google\Service\Safebrowsing(...);
* $threatListUpdates = $safebrowsingService->threatListUpdates;
* </code>
*/
class ThreatListUpdates extends \Google\Service\Resource
{
/**
* Fetches the most recent threat list updates. A client can request updates for
* multiple lists at once. (threatListUpdates.fetch)
*
* @param GoogleSecuritySafebrowsingV4FetchThreatListUpdatesRequest $postBody
* @param array $optParams Optional parameters.
* @return GoogleSecuritySafebrowsingV4FetchThreatListUpdatesResponse
*/
public function fetch(GoogleSecuritySafebrowsingV4FetchThreatListUpdatesRequest $postBody, $optParams = [])
{
$params = ['postBody' => $postBody];
$params = array_merge($params, $optParams);
return $this->call('fetch', [$params], GoogleSecuritySafebrowsingV4FetchThreatListUpdatesResponse::class);
}
}
// Adding a class alias for backwards compatibility with the previous class name.
class_alias(ThreatListUpdates::class, 'Google_Service_Safebrowsing_Resource_ThreatListUpdates');
